The (G, \θ)-Lie algebras are structures which unify the Lie algebras and\nLie superalgebras. We use them to produce solutions for the quantum Yang-Baxter\nequation. The constant and the spectral-parameter Yang-Baxter equations and\nYang-Baxter systems are also studied.\n
